This is a recipe from the Barefoot Contessa; I tweaked it just a smidge.
3 cups flour
2 cups sugar
2 tsp baking powder
1 tsp baking soda
1/2 tsp salt
1/2 pound unsalted butter, melted & cooled
2 XL eggs
3/4 cup whole milk
2 tsp vanilla
2 bananas, mashed
1 banana, diced
1 cup diced walnuts, optional
1 cup granola
1 cup sweetened coconut, dried banana chips or granola
Preheat the oven to 350 degrees.
Line 24 muffin cups with liners, or spray with Pam
Sift the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da and salt into the bowl of an electric mixer with a paddle attachment.
Add the melted butter and blend.
Add the eggs, milk, vanilla and mashed bananas.
Scrape the bowl and blend well; be careful not to overmix.
Fold the diced bananas, (walnuts), granola and coconut into the batter.
Spoon the batter into the prepared pans, filling each cup to the top.
Top each muffin with banana chips, granola or coconut, if desired.
Bake 30 minutes, until the tops are golden brown.
Makes 24 average-sized muffins.
